I have an HP PSC 1601 All-in-One Printer-Scanner-Copier... How do I get the scanner to work?

When I press the scan button, it says this:





No Scan Options. You need to install or run device software for feature.

I've had 2 HP All in One machines (different model #'s than yours) and experienced this same problem.





Apparently you can only scan items by opening the HP printer software that you should have installed on your computer already. For my printer, that feature is available through the HP Solution Center program. Go to the Start Menu and find the HP folder, it should be accessible from there.





I think it's some HP/Windows compatibility issue that doesn't allow you to just press the ';Scan'; button. First of all, remove the usb cable from the HP and power it on. Now install the software and re-connect the USB cable only when the software asks you, not before.





Let if finish installation and REBOOT the computer





windows will find the scanner and advise you. Now open the scanning software which you will find in your START meu ALL PROGRAMS%26gt; Go to the HP folder and click on the scanning program.





Go under the FILE menu and select SCAN., It should work perfectly.
You should have the software cd that came with the printer when you purchased it. If you can't find it you can go to HP's site and possibly download it.
